GL Tech Co.,Ltd (SZSE:300480) Surges 7.8%; Individual Investors Who Own 51% Shares Profited Along With Insiders

Key Insights

  • GL TechLtd's significant individual investors ownership suggests that the key decisions are influenced by shareholders from the larger public
  • The top 25 shareholders own 49% of the company
  • 40% of GL TechLtd is held by insiders

A look at the shareholders of GL Tech Co.,Ltd (SZSE:300480) can tell us which group is most powerful. The group holding the most number of shares in the company, around 51% to be precise, is individual investors. Put another way, the group faces the maximum upside potential (or downside risk).

While individual investors were the group that benefitted the most from last week's CN¥459m market cap gain, insiders too had a 40% share in those profits.

What Does The Institutional Ownership Tell Us About GL TechLtd?

Institutional investors commonly compare their own returns to the returns of a commonly followed index. So they generally do consider buying larger companies that are included in the relevant benchmark index.

Less than 5% of GL TechLtd is held by institutional investors. This suggests that some funds have the company in their sights, but many have not yet bought shares in it. If the company is growing earnings, that may indicate that it is just beginning to catch the attention of these deep-pocketed investors. When multiple institutional investors want to buy shares, we often see a rising share price. Hedge funds don't have many shares in GL TechLtd. With a 38% stake, CEO Tong Yu Zhao is the largest shareholder. In comparison, the second and third largest shareholders hold about 4.2% and 1.6% of the stock.

A deeper look at our ownership data shows that the top 25 shareholders collectively hold less than half of the register, suggesting a large group of small holders where no single shareholder has a majority.

Insider Ownership Of GL TechLtd

The definition of an insider can differ slightly between different countries, but members of the board of directors always count. Management ultimately answers to the board. However, it is not uncommon for managers to be executive board members, especially if they are a founder or the CEO.

Most consider insider ownership a positive because it can indicate the board is well aligned with other shareholders. However, on some occasions too much power is concentrated within this group.

Our information suggests that insiders maintain a significant holding in GL Tech Co.,Ltd. It has a market capitalization of just CN¥5.8b, and insiders have CN¥2.3b worth of shares in their own names. General Public Ownership

The general public, who are usually individual investors, hold a substantial 51% stake in GL TechLtd, suggesting it is a fairly popular stock. This level of ownership gives investors from the wider public some power to sway key policy decisions such as board composition, executive compensation, and the dividend payout ratio.

Private Company Ownership

It seems that Private Companies own 6.7%, of the GL TechLtd stock. Private companies may be related parties. Sometimes insiders have an interest in a public company through a holding in a private company, rather than in their own capacity as an individual. While it's hard to draw any broad stroke conclusions, it is worth noting as an area for further research.
